Ekshef.com, Egypt's premier online doctor appointment booking platform, has reached a significant milestone by completing three years of operations, significantly improving healthcare accessibility across the nation. Founded by Khaled Khamis, a software engineer with a science background, the platform has expanded its network to include over 11,000 certified physicians in major cities such as Cairo, Giza, and Alexandria.
Since its inception in 2022, Ekshef.com has set itself apart with a user-friendly interface that simplifies the process of searching for and booking appointments with medical specialists in various fields, including cardiology, dermatology, and pediatrics. The platform's growth has been supported by approximately $250,000 in funding from angel investors, enabling enhancements to its technological infrastructure and user experience.
